CASA: changes in windows makefile -continue
This commit is contained in:
		| @@ -47,6 +47,8 @@ export MONO_PATH := $(MONO_PATH) | |||||||
| PLATFORMINDEPENDENTSOURCEDIR = ..  | PLATFORMINDEPENDENTSOURCEDIR = ..  | ||||||
| PLATFORMDEPENDENTSOURCEDIR = . | PLATFORMDEPENDENTSOURCEDIR = . | ||||||
|  |  | ||||||
|  | OBJDIR = ./BUILT | ||||||
|  |  | ||||||
| MODULE_NAME =CASA | MODULE_NAME =CASA | ||||||
| MODULE_EXT =msi | MODULE_EXT =msi | ||||||
|  |  | ||||||
| @@ -69,9 +71,9 @@ $(MODULE_NAME).$(MODULE_EXT): $(SFILES) $(OBJDIR) devenv | |||||||
| 	"$(TOOLDIR)/w32/VersionVDProj/bin/VersionVDProj.exe" -msi $(MSIFILE) version=$(VERSION)  | 	"$(TOOLDIR)/w32/VersionVDProj/bin/VersionVDProj.exe" -msi $(MSIFILE) version=$(VERSION)  | ||||||
| 	@echo [======== Building Solution $(SFILES) ========] | 	@echo [======== Building Solution $(SFILES) ========] | ||||||
| 	"$(VSINSTALLDIR)\devenv" /rebuild $(TARGET_CFG) $(SFILES) /out build.log  | 	"$(VSINSTALLDIR)\devenv" /rebuild $(TARGET_CFG) $(SFILES) /out build.log  | ||||||
| 	cp -f $(TARGET_CFG)/$(MODULE_NAME).$(MODULE_EXT) ./BUILT  | 	cp -f $(TARGET_CFG)/$(MODULE_NAME).$(MODULE_EXT) $(OBJDIR)  | ||||||
| 	cp -f $(TARGET_CFG)/setup.exe ./BUILT  | 	cp -f $(TARGET_CFG)/setup.exe $(OBJDIR)  | ||||||
| 	tar -cvf $(PACKAGE)-$(VERSION).tar ./BUILT | 	tar -cvf $(PACKAGE)-$(VERSION).tar $(OBJDIR)  | ||||||
| 	bzip2 -z $(PACKAGE)-$(VERSION).tar | 	bzip2 -z $(PACKAGE)-$(VERSION).tar | ||||||
|  |  | ||||||
| 	 | 	 | ||||||
| @@ -80,8 +82,6 @@ devenv: | |||||||
|   |   | ||||||
| $(OBJDIR): | $(OBJDIR): | ||||||
| 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R) | 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R) | ||||||
| 	[ -d $(CASABINDIR) ] || mkdir -p $(CASABINDIR) |  | ||||||
| 	[ -d BUILT ] || mkdir -p BUILT  |  | ||||||
|  |  | ||||||
|  |  | ||||||
| install-exec-local: $(OBJDIR)/$(MODULE_NAME).$(MODULE_EXT) | install-exec-local: $(OBJDIR)/$(MODULE_NAME).$(MODULE_EXT) | ||||||
| @@ -103,7 +103,7 @@ clean-local: | |||||||
| 	if [ -d $(TARGET_CFG) ]; then  rm -rf $(TARGET_CFG); fi | 	if [ -d $(TARGET_CFG) ]; then  rm -rf $(TARGET_CFG); fi | ||||||
| 	if [ -d Debug ]; then  rm -rf Debug; fi | 	if [ -d Debug ]; then  rm -rf Debug; fi | ||||||
| 	if [ -f build.log ]; then  rm -f build.log; fi | 	if [ -f build.log ]; then  rm -f build.log; fi | ||||||
| 	if [ -d BUILT ]; then rm -rf BUILT; fi | 	if [ -d $(OBJDIR) ]; then rm -rf $(OBJDIR); fi | ||||||
| 	if [ -f $(PACKAGE)-$(VERSION).tar.bz2 ]; then rm -f $(PACKAGE)-$(VERSION).tar.bz2; fi | 	if [ -f $(PACKAGE)-$(VERSION).tar.bz2 ]; then rm -f $(PACKAGE)-$(VERSION).tar.bz2; fi | ||||||
| distclean-local: | distclean-local: | ||||||
|  |  | ||||||
|   | |||||||
| @@ -47,6 +47,8 @@ export MONO_PATH := $(MONO_PATH) | |||||||
| PLATFORMINDEPENDENTSOURCEDIR = ..  | PLATFORMINDEPENDENTSOURCEDIR = ..  | ||||||
| PLATFORMDEPENDENTSOURCEDIR = . | PLATFORMDEPENDENTSOURCEDIR = . | ||||||
|  |  | ||||||
|  | OBJDIR = ../BUILT | ||||||
|  |  | ||||||
| MODULE_NAME =CASA_x64 | MODULE_NAME =CASA_x64 | ||||||
| MODULE_EXT =msi | MODULE_EXT =msi | ||||||
|  |  | ||||||
| @@ -71,11 +73,11 @@ $(MODULE_NAME).$(MODULE_EXT): $(SFILES) $(OBJDIR) devenv | |||||||
| 	"$(TOOLDIR)/w32/VersionVDProj/bin/VersionVDProj.exe" -msi $(MSIFILE) version=$(VERSION)  | 	"$(TOOLDIR)/w32/VersionVDProj/bin/VersionVDProj.exe" -msi $(MSIFILE) version=$(VERSION)  | ||||||
| 	@echo [======== Building Solution $(SFILES) ========] | 	@echo [======== Building Solution $(SFILES) ========] | ||||||
| 	"$(VSINSTALLDIR)\devenv" /rebuild $(TARGET_CFG) $(SFILES) /out build.log  | 	"$(VSINSTALLDIR)\devenv" /rebuild $(TARGET_CFG) $(SFILES) /out build.log  | ||||||
| 	cp -f $(TARGET_CFG)/$(MODULE_NAME).$(MODULE_EXT) ../BUILT/bin64  | 	cp -f $(TARGET_CFG)/$(MODULE_NAME).$(MODULE_EXT) $(OBJDIR)/bin64  | ||||||
| 	cp -f $(TARGET_CFG)/setup.exe ../BUILT/bin64  | 	cp -f $(TARGET_CFG)/setup.exe $(OBJDIR)/bin64  | ||||||
| 	cp -p ../CASA32-msi/$(TARGET_CFG)/setup.exe ../BUILT/bin | 	cp -p ../CASA32-msi/$(TARGET_CFG)/setup.exe $(OBJDIR)/bin | ||||||
| 	cp -p ../CASA32-msi/$(TARGET_CFG)/CASA.msi ../BUILT/bin | 	cp -p ../CASA32-msi/$(TARGET_CFG)/CASA.msi $(OBJDIR)/bin | ||||||
| 	tar -cvf $(PACKAGE)-$(VERSION).tar ./BUILT | 	tar -cvf $(PACKAGE)-$(VERSION).tar $(OBJDIR) | ||||||
| 	bzip2 -z $(PACKAGE)-$(VERSION).tar | 	bzip2 -z $(PACKAGE)-$(VERSION).tar | ||||||
|  |  | ||||||
| 	 | 	 | ||||||
| @@ -83,11 +85,10 @@ devenv: | |||||||
| 	@if ! test -x "$(VSINSTALLDIR)\devenv.exe";then echo "Error: MS Studio .NET is currently required to build MSI and MSM";exit 1;fi | 	@if ! test -x "$(VSINSTALLDIR)\devenv.exe";then echo "Error: MS Studio .NET is currently required to build MSI and MSM";exit 1;fi | ||||||
|   |   | ||||||
| $(OBJDIR): | $(OBJDIR): | ||||||
|  | 	echo "creating obj dir"	 | ||||||
| 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R)  | 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R)  | ||||||
| 	[ -d $(CASABINDIR) ] || mkdir -p $(CASABINDIR) | 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R)/bin64  | ||||||
| 	[ -d ../BUILT ] || mkdir -p ../BUILT  | 	[ -d $(OBJDIR) ] || mkdir -p $(OBJDIR)/bin  | ||||||
| 	[ -d ../BUILT ] || mkdir -p ../BUILT/bin64  |  | ||||||
| 	[ -d ../BUILT ] || mkdir -p ../BUILT/bin  |  | ||||||
|  |  | ||||||
|  |  | ||||||
| install-exec-local: $(OBJDIR)/$(MODULE_NAME).$(MODULE_EXT) | install-exec-local: $(OBJDIR)/$(MODULE_NAME).$(MODULE_EXT) | ||||||
|   | |||||||
		Reference in New Issue
	
	Block a user